Assistant Editor, Fiction (12 month FTC)

Application Deadline: 6 September 2026

Department: Editorial

Employment Type: Fixed Term Contract

Location: London

Compensation: £31,500 - £32,000 / year

Description

We have a brilliant opportunity to work with our bestselling General Fiction list, working to support our two Publishing Directors and a Commissioning Editor, as part of our busy, friendly General Fiction team. It’s a role that offers a broad range of responsibilities, with a focus on editorial support for some of our key brand authors, production support for the busy list, and some direct contact with authors and management of their publishing. The role also includes administrative tasks across the General Fiction team and an ability to prioritise is key. We’re looking for someone with practical editing experience in a commercially focused publishing team, who is passionate about popular fiction, romance and great storytelling.

Key Responsibilities

Editorial:

  • Working closely with the Publishing Directors to give editorial support on their authors

  • Managing all aspects of production on their titles and seeing them through the production process, including booking freelancers

  • Doing structural and line edits as needed or alongside the Publishing Directors and working with authors

  • Checking copy-edits, resolving queries and collating page proofs

  • Completing ebook editorial checks

  • Writing and preparing cover and launch briefs, and cover copy

  • Creating Advance Information sheets to key sales deadlines, monitoring and updating them

  • Inputting metadata across all relevant titles and monitoring it – including checking Amazon - to ensure it remains relevant and up to date

  • Proof-reading cover runouts, author presentations, short stories and other texts, as well as sales and marketing material, e.g. catalogues, rights sheets, presenters

  • Creating author questionnaires, reading group questions and other extra content

  • Reading and reporting speedily on submissions shared by the Publisher or Publishing Director

Administration:

  • Liaison on Publishing Directors’ behalf with authors, agents, and other departments

  • Provide advance/sample materials to internal divisions

  • Organising purchase orders and processing invoices

  • Supplying TCM figures, international sales figures and overall sales analysis

  • Raising new contracts

  • Ordering gratis copies for authors

  • Taking minutes when necessary at inhouse meetings

  • Sending out proofs for advance quotes

Skills, Knowledge and Expertise

  • Previous experience in Trade Editorial

  • Project-management experience – effective at multi-tasking, with the ability to cope in a pressurised environment

  • Direct liaison with authors, agents, and other departments within the publishing company

  • Editing and writing copy experience

  • Reliable and demonstrates initiative

  • Effective communicator at all levels

  • A keen eye for detail

  • Advanced MS Word and Intermediate Excel and Outlook
